Description
A GERMAN SILVER TWO-HANDLED TRAY
MARK OF GEBRÜDER FRIEDLANDER, BERLIN, LATE 19TH/20TH CENTURY
Details
Rounded rectangular, the gadrooned rim with shells flanked by acanthus at the corners, with conforming handles, engraved at the underside REPRODUKTION VON 1821 / GEORG IV., marked on underside
29 in. (73.7 cm.) long, over handles
123 oz. 2 dwt. (3,828 gr.)
